About the Role

As a key member of the Commercial Strategy Leadership Team, the Principal will drive commercial strategy advisory services with life sciences clients, focusing on areas like Corporate & Portfolio Strategy, New Product Planning, BD&L Support, and Launch/Go-to-Market Strategy. This role involves identifying innovative initiatives, contributing as a strategic business partner, and leading client proposal and project delivery.

About the Company

  • Trinity powers the future of life sciences commercialization through the fusion of human and artificial intelligence.
  • Trinity blends deep therapeutic expertise and trusted human ingenuity with a purpose-built technology platform.
  • Trinity accelerates clarity and confidence at every step of the commercialization journey—from pre-launch to scale to loss of exclusivity.
  • For over 30 years, leading pharmaceutical, biotech, and medtech companies have relied on Trinity’s foresight, execution, and partnership.
  • Trinity delivers confident product launches, decisive market advantage, and measurable patient impact.
  • Trinity has expanded from its first office in Waltham, MA to 1,300 professionals across 14 offices and five continents.
  • Trinity sets new industry standards in quality, responsiveness, and client partnership.
